esp8266: Switch integer arith routines to BootROM.

This commit is contained in:
Paul Sokolovsky 2016-04-14 14:24:25 +03:00
parent df3b1741b6
commit 0a400a6333

@ -50,8 +50,8 @@ PROVIDE ( _UserExceptionVector = 0x40000050 );
PROVIDE ( __adddf3 = 0x4000c538 ); PROVIDE ( __adddf3 = 0x4000c538 );
PROVIDE ( __addsf3 = 0x4000c180 ); PROVIDE ( __addsf3 = 0x4000c180 );
PROVIDE ( __divdf3 = 0x4000cb94 ); PROVIDE ( __divdf3 = 0x4000cb94 );
PROVIDE ( __divdi3 = 0x4000ce60 ); __divdi3 = 0x4000ce60;
PROVIDE ( __divsi3 = 0x4000dc88 ); __divsi3 = 0x4000dc88;
PROVIDE ( __extendsfdf2 = 0x4000cdfc ); PROVIDE ( __extendsfdf2 = 0x4000cdfc );
PROVIDE ( __fixdfsi = 0x4000ccb8 ); PROVIDE ( __fixdfsi = 0x4000ccb8 );
PROVIDE ( __fixunsdfsi = 0x4000cd00 ); PROVIDE ( __fixunsdfsi = 0x4000cd00 );
@ -61,16 +61,16 @@ PROVIDE ( __floatsisf = 0x4000e2ac );
PROVIDE ( __floatunsidf = 0x4000e2e8 ); PROVIDE ( __floatunsidf = 0x4000e2e8 );
PROVIDE ( __floatunsisf = 0x4000e2a4 ); PROVIDE ( __floatunsisf = 0x4000e2a4 );
PROVIDE ( __muldf3 = 0x4000c8f0 ); PROVIDE ( __muldf3 = 0x4000c8f0 );
PROVIDE ( __muldi3 = 0x40000650 ); __muldi3 = 0x40000650;
PROVIDE ( __mulsf3 = 0x4000c3dc ); PROVIDE ( __mulsf3 = 0x4000c3dc );
PROVIDE ( __subdf3 = 0x4000c688 ); PROVIDE ( __subdf3 = 0x4000c688 );
PROVIDE ( __subsf3 = 0x4000c268 ); PROVIDE ( __subsf3 = 0x4000c268 );
PROVIDE ( __truncdfsf2 = 0x4000cd5c ); PROVIDE ( __truncdfsf2 = 0x4000cd5c );
PROVIDE ( __udivdi3 = 0x4000d310 ); __udivdi3 = 0x4000d310;
PROVIDE ( __udivsi3 = 0x4000e21c ); __udivsi3 = 0x4000e21c;
PROVIDE ( __umoddi3 = 0x4000d770 ); __umoddi3 = 0x4000d770;
PROVIDE ( __umodsi3 = 0x4000e268 ); __umodsi3 = 0x4000e268;
PROVIDE ( __umulsidi3 = 0x4000dcf0 ); __umulsidi3 = 0x4000dcf0;
PROVIDE ( _rom_store = 0x4000e388 ); PROVIDE ( _rom_store = 0x4000e388 );
PROVIDE ( _rom_store_table = 0x4000e328 ); PROVIDE ( _rom_store_table = 0x4000e328 );
PROVIDE ( _start = 0x4000042c ); PROVIDE ( _start = 0x4000042c );